We've pulled together some statistics and other details to help you see how the history program at Nicholls State University stacks up to those at other schools.Nicholls State University is located in Thibodaux, Louisiana and approximately 6,769 students attend the school each year. In 2021, 24 history majors received their bachelor's degree from Nicholls State University.

Careers That History Grads May Go Into
A degree in history can lead to the following careers. Since job numbers and average salaries can vary by geographic location, we have only included the numbers for LA, the home state for Nicholls State University.
Occupation | Jobs in LA | Average Salary in LA |
---|---|---|
High School Teachers | 13,930 | $51,810 |
Managers | 9,790 | $87,080 |
Curators | 140 | $42,190 |
History Professors | 110 | $71,360 |
Museum Technicians and Conservators | 100 | $24,690 |
